Transaction bc67000d6b7966e296496e7111c8b3124d1ea82efbbe7b2d05f4de055639efa3
1 Input
1 Output
-
bc67000d6b7966e296496e7111c8b3124d1ea82efbbe7b2d05f4de055639efa3:0
- value
- 661896
- script pubkey
- OP_0 OP_PUSHBYTES_20 e23bb297b7a84aa81e7ac17731c6d7ad81446dfd
- address
- bc1qugam99ah4p92s8n6c9mnr3kh4kq5gm0anw8m0x